With sustainable finances a hot topic you might be inclined to think that building a new stadium like Tottenham did would be a sensible plan to create high sustainable revenue... but there's a problem... the cost in building one is constantly on the climb.

Suj and James discuss the rising costs versus the need for clubs like Chelsea and Manchester United to build and for clubs like Aston Villa and Newcastle to upgrade what they have.

But has the moment gone?

And there are examples used from Tottenham and West Ham's recent moves to show the difference that can be made to revenue and sustainability.
